PayPal has an employee rating of 3.6 out of 5 stars, based on 9,629 company reviews on Glassdoor which indicates that most employees have a good working experience there. The PayPal employee rating is in line with the average (within 1 standard deviation) for employers within the Information Technology industry (3.7 stars).
